Esempio n. 1
0
    def test_lfloat(self):
        values = (12.123, 1.321)
        format = '88'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        values = (9.1, 3.1)
        format = '88'
        self.assertEqual(unpack(format, pack(format, *values)), values)
Esempio n. 2
0
    def test_ufloat(self):
        values = (123.2, 100.12)
        format = '66'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        values = (12.2, 10.12)
        format = '66'
        self.assertEqual(unpack(format, pack(format, *values)), values)
Esempio n. 3
0
    def test_lfloat(self):
        values = (12.123, 1.321)
        format = '88'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        values = (9.1, 3.1)
        format = '88'
        self.assertEqual(unpack(format, pack(format, *values)), values)
Esempio n. 4
0
    def test_ufloat(self):
        values = (123.2, 100.12)
        format = '66'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        values = (12.2, 10.12)
        format = '66'
        self.assertEqual(unpack(format, pack(format, *values)), values)
Esempio n. 5
0
    def test_format(self):
        values = (1, 6, 3, 199)
        format = '1111'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        values = (-43, 12, 3991)
        format = '211'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        macaddr = 'AABBCCDDEEFF'
        values = (macaddr, 3212, -99912, 32943)
        format = '3154'
        self.assertEqual(unpack(format, pack(format, *values)), values)
Esempio n. 6
0
    def test_format(self):
        values = (1, 6, 3, 199)
        format = '1111'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        values = (-43, 12, 3991)
        format = '211'
        self.assertEqual(unpack(format, pack(format, *values)), values)

        macaddr = 'AABBCCDDEEFF'
        values = (macaddr, 3212, -99912, 32943)
        format = '3154'
        self.assertEqual(unpack(format, pack(format, *values)), values)